Comprehending Registered Agents

A registered agent is a official individual or business entity that acts as a point of for judicial paperwork and government correspondence on behalf of a limited liability company. They are in charge of receiving court documents, which includes any court summons that may occur in the course of company activities. This guarantees that businesses can efficiently handle their legal obligations without the risk of missing vital information.

The criteria for these agents can vary by state, but usually, they must have a physical address within the region where the company is incorporated. This indicates that a post office box is usually not acceptable. Many organizations choose to engage the services of registered agents to guarantee compliance with local laws and to simplify the administrative responsibilities associated with maintaining a registered office.

Using a reliable representative can provide several benefits, including greater privacy, as the agent's location is on record instead of the owner's address. This arrangement also enables owners to dedicate themselves to their primary operations while ensuring that they have a reliable means for managing legal and compliance issues, including the prompt submission of necessary filings and other required paperwork.

Registered Agent Obligations and Fees

When starting a business, grasping the requirements for registered agents is crucial. In general, all states require that businesses designate a registered agent to manage legal documents and official communications. The registered agent needs to possess a physical address in the state of establishment and be available during normal business hours. This ensures that the business can be reliably contacted for important legal matters. Some states enable businesses to serve as their own registered agent, but many opt to hire a third-party registered agent for added security and compliance.

The expenses associated with hiring a registered agent can vary significantly based on the level of support and the provider selected. Basic  registered agent service s can be available for a few hundred dollars per year, while more advanced options, which may incorporate additional services like mail forwarding or compliance reminders, can cost from 300 to 500 dollars annually. It’s crucial to evaluate registered agent service prices and services to find an option that fits both the financial plan and objectives.

Investing in a trustworthy registered agent is often seen as a wise strategy for guaranteeing adherence and maintaining good standing with state regulations. While seeking affordable registered agent services, businesses should think about the long-term benefits of a reliable agent. Considerations such as their responsiveness, service quality, and additional support features, like compliance reminders and legal document handling, should be balanced with the costs to determine the best registered agent options for your individual business.

Renewing and Changing Your Registered Agent

Changing your designated agent is an essential aspect of upholding your business standing. Most regions require registered agents to be reappointed annually, ensuring that the agent is still qualified to serve in this position. It's important to keep your registered agent service up to date to prevent any regulatory issues that could impact your business functioning. To reappoint, typically, you need to check with your nominee agent provider that their services will continue and cover any associated update fees.

If you decide to switch your registered agent, the procedure usually involves submitting a switch registered agent form with the appropriate state agency. This might come with a switch fee, and it’s essential to make sure that the new nominee agent meets all legal agent criteria. Regardless of whether you are moving to a local designated agent or selecting an online registered agent service, make sure that the new agent can meet required responsibilities, such as managing service of process and upholding an official nominee office.

Engagement with both your old and new nominee agent is essential during this change. Inform your existing agent of the change to eliminate any potential gaps in service, and confirm with your new designated agent provider that they are ready to take over. Documenting these updates will help in ensuring that your business remains compliant with state requirements while meeting all deadlines for annual reports and statutory filings.
